The A380 Is Dead, Long Live The A380

Matthew Klint Posted onFebruary 14, 2019November 14, 2023 9 Comments
a large airplane flying in the sky

Airbus announced today that it would be shutting the A380 production line in 2021. The move is sadly not a surprise. 17 A380s will still be built, including 14 to Emirates and 3 to ANA. Quick And Easy: Joining German EasyPASS “Global Entry” Program

Matthew Klint Posted onSeptember 4, 2018November 14, 2023 12 Comments
German EasyPass Guide

During my transit through Frankfurt last month, I had an opportunity to join the German Trusted Traveler Program called EasyPASS.
